Malicious (“black hat”) hackers (or crackers) commonly use port scanning software to find which ports are “open” (unfiltered) in a given computer, and whether or not an actual service is listening on that port. They can then attempt to exploit potential vulnerabilities in any services they find.
Can I be hacked through an open port?
Open port does not immediately mean a security issue. But, it can provide a pathway for attackers to the application listening on that port. Therefore, attackers can exploit shortcomings like weak credentials, no two-factor authentication, or even vulnerabilities in the application itself.

How do hackers scan ports?
During a port scan, hackers send a message to each port, one at a time. The response they receive from each port determines whether it’s being used and reveals potential weaknesses. Security techs can routinely conduct port scanning for network inventory and to expose possible security vulnerabilities.
Which ports should be blocked on firewall?
For example, the SANS Institute recommends blocking outbound traffic that uses the following ports:
- MS RPC TCP & UDP port 135.
- NetBIOS/IP TCP & UDP ports 137-139.
- SMB/IP TCP port 445.
- Trivial File Transfer Protocol (TFTP) UDP port 69.
- Syslog UDP port 514.

What is nikto used for?
Nikto is a free software command-line vulnerability scanner that scans webservers for dangerous files/CGIs, outdated server software and other problems. It performs generic and server type specific checks. It also captures and prints any cookies received.
What is Nessus used for?
Nessus is a remote security scanning tool, which scans a computer and raises an alert if it discovers any vulnerabilities that malicious hackers could use to gain access to any computer you have connected to a network.

Why is port 443 open?
If port 443 is open on a computer, that usually means web servers are waiting for a connection from a web browser. You can test whether the port is open by attempting to open an HTTPS connection to the computer using its domain name or IP address.
